The 240GB Mercury Accelsior PCI Express Solid State Drive Card from Other World Computing is the world's first bootable PCI Express solid state drive card for both Mac and Windows. This high-performance SSD is bootable on PCs and is the only Mac-bootable, Mac supported PCIe SSD available at the moment. You will actually be able to boot from the Mercury Accelsior without having to install any drivers because it's a true Plug and Play solution. With its custom SandForce Driven Accelsior SSD blades, the Mercury Accelsior card enables Mac and PC users to enjoy a more responsive and productive computing experience along with cooler, quieter and more energy efficient operation, especially when compared to traditional mechanical hard disk drives.
Offering nearly three times the performance of a regular solid state drive in a SATA 2.0 3Gb/s drive bay, the Mercury Accelsior is perfect for I/O-intensive applications, such as Photoshop, Final Cut Pro and Avid Pro Tools. Rendering, capturing and processing media files require high sustained data transfer speeds and the Mercury Accelsior delivers with up to a 762MB/s read speed and up to a 763MB/s write speed. Keep in mind that those speeds are when the Mercury Accelsior is connected to a Sandy Bridge Intel processor. It can have a sustained read speed of up to 823MB/s and a sustained write speed of up to 772MB/s when connected to an Ivy Bridge processor.
| Performance | |
|---|---|
| Controller | Dual LSI SandForce SF-2281 Series Processors (with 7% over provisioning) |
| NAND | Tier 1 Major 2X-nm Multi-Level Cell (MLC) High-Performance Sync-NAND Flash |
| Form Factor | Low Profile PCI Express |
| Capacity | 240GB |
| Interface |
PCIe 2.0 x2 |
| Sustained Transfer Rate |
Sandy Bridge Ivy Bridge |
| Sustained Random 4k Read/Write | Up to 100,000 IOPS |
| Latency | Less than 0.1ms |
